Binance to Roll Out Spot Price Range Protection (PRER) on April 14
Binance is introducing a new safety feature. Starting April 14th, 2026, the exchange will roll out Spot Price Range Protection (PRER) to prevent user orders from being filled at abnormal prices during extreme market conditions.
The mechanism allows orders to execute only within a dynamic price range. The goal is to shield the market from sharp price deviations caused by abnormal activity and maintain a fair, orderly trading environment.

Key features: orders with execution prices outside the specified range will be canceled—though filled portions will settle as usual. The system helps protect against rapid, large price swings and ensures fairness during periods of market stress. Binance said the mechanism won't affect everyday trading under normal market prices.
